reticulation

Reikšmė (Anglų k.)

  1. (countable, uncountable) A network of criss-crossing lines, strands, cables or pipes.
  2. (countable, uncountable) A method of copying a painting by the help of threads stretched across a frame.

Etimologija (Anglų k.)

From reticule + -ation.
